Industry Insights: Navigating the Mining Ecosystem
Market reports indicate that the global cryptocurrency mining sector is worth over USD 30 billion, with Asia-Pacific dominating the scene. However, despite the lucrative prospects, the sector faces hurdles: rising energy costs, technological obsolescence, and increasing regulatory scrutiny. Consequently, choosing a reputable platform becomes imperative.
| Criterion | Description | Industry Benchmark |
|---|---|---|
| Transparency | Clear reporting on hardware, energy consumption, and payout structures. | 100% adherence to disclosed metrics; third-party audits. |
| Operational Track Record | Years of service, uptime, and customer testimonials. | Minimum of 3 years with >99.9% uptime. |
| Regulatory Compliance | Adherence to local laws and licensing. | Proper licensing and registration, avoiding legal grey zones. |
| Customer Support | Availability and responsiveness of support channels. | 24/7 support with dedicated account managers. |
The Role of a Credible Registration Guide in Investor Confidence
In an increasingly cluttered market, many newcomers struggle to differentiate between credible providers and fleeting schemes. Here, the emphasis on a reliable registration guide is critical. It ensures potential users understand the registration prerequisites, verification steps, and legal considerations, thereby fostering transparency and trust.
For example, a well-structured registration guide should detail:
- The required personal and financial documentation for KYC (Know Your Customer) compliance.
- The process for establishing secure accounts and safeguarding private keys.
- Procedures for depositing funds and commencing mining activities officially.
- Guidelines for ongoing account management and updates.
